Quick Check Of TPMS
Some car models and model years require that you are more accurate when aiming the diagnostic tool at the sensor for an activation to succeed. If an activation fails, realign the diagnostic tool and perform the activation again. First after three (3) failed activation attempts can a sensor be regarded as defective.
The system can be checked, using the diagnostic tool, by activating a readout at the same time as activating the sensors using a special tool. The special tool is positioned against the tire where the sensor is located at the same time as the button on the special tool is depressed. The special tool then transmits a signal that activates the sensor so that it starts to send signals to the central electronic module (CEM). The activated sensor ID number and tire pressure is then shown in the display of the diagnostic tool. Note the sensor's id-number and its position.
